A rectifier converts alternating current (AC) to direct current (DC), providing stable DC power essential for various electrical devices and systems in industrial applications.
Silicon semiconductors offer high efficiency, reliability, and thermal stability, making them ideal for diode bridges that handle AC to DC conversion with minimal power loss.
The aluminum heat sink dissipates heat generated during operation, preventing overheating and ensuring consistent performance, longevity, and safety of the rectifier.
